Thank you to everyone who responded to this question. The solution came from forums.mysql.com, in a thread titled “MyODBC Driver doesn’t show up on driver list.” The problem was with the registry which was keeping several drivers from showing up. There is a very excellent description of how to solve the problem written by Mark LaCroix (he acknowleges credit due to others as well.) This post resolved my problem exactly, and it is apparently somewhat common.
